电流行波差动式母线保护的研究
STUDY ON THE CURRENT TRAVELING-WAVE DIFFERENTIAL BUS PROTECTION
【摘要】 为避免电流互感器暂态饱和的影响,研究了一种基于暂态电流行波的新型母线保护。在对母线上线路各相电流行波差动量的故障特征进行分析的基础上,为提高判别母线区内外故障的灵敏度,又引入各相电流行波的制动量,提出一种具有比率制动特性的电流行波差动式母线保护,及其基于小波变换的实用比率判据。理论分析和EMTP仿真表明该母线保护快速、灵敏、可靠,基本不受故障类型、故障过渡电阻、故障距离和故障初始角的影响。
【Abstract】 To avoid the influence of the current transformer transient saturation, this paper studies a novel bus protection based on the transient current traveling-waves. On the basis of analyzing the fault feature of the differential traveling-wave in each phase of the transmission lines connected to the protected bus, the restraint traveling-wave in each phase is introduced to improve the sensitivity of distinguishing bus internal faults from external faults. Accordingly this paper presents the bus protection of differential traveling-waves with the percentage bias restraint characteristic, and then proposes the bus protection practicable criterion using the wavelet transform. The theoretical analysis and EMTP simulation show that the bus protection operates rapidly, sensitively and reliably, and its performance can endure the influences of various fault types, fault path resistances, fault positions and fault inception angles.
【Key words】 bus protection; current transformer saturation; current traveling-wave; differential; wavelet transform;
